Overview of Dry Socket Paste

Defining Dry Socket Paste: What Type of Medicine Is It?

Dry Socket Paste, featuring the active ingredients Eugenol and Guaiacol, is a specialized topical formulation used in dental medicine. It is defined as an intra-alveolar dressing or dental paste, a semisolid preparation intended for topical application directly into the surgical site following tooth extraction. It is classified as a combined Analgesic and Antiseptic Dental Agent. This classification signifies its dual function: to mitigate pain and to counteract localized microbial activity. The paste operates outside the systemic circulation, allowing its action to be highly localized, providing a functional approach for managing discomfort directly related to an exposed surgical site.


Composition and Differentiation: The Role of Eugenol and Guaiacol

The therapeutic foundation of this combination is the inclusion of the active ingredients Eugenol and Guaiacol, both of which are chemically classified as phenol derivatives. This combination product utilizes Eugenol for its sedative effects on nerve endings. While Eugenol is often derived from clove oil, Guaiacol is typically a synthesized compound; both are integrated into an oily/viscous base to create the persistent dental paste. The paste's distinguishing feature is its high viscosity and non-dissolving nature, allowing it to maintain a stable, protective dressing within the alveolar socket, a distinct characteristic compared to liquid or rapidly dissolving rinses.


General Purpose: The Benefit of an Intra-alveolar Dressing

The general benefit of this specific preparation is to offer targeted relief and site protection for post-operative dental surgery patients. The paste’s design allows the active components to deliver a soothing obtundent action on irritated nerve endings. Simultaneously, the primary components contribute to localized disinfection, helping to stabilize the area by inhibiting the growth of common oral bacteria. This combination provides a physical protective barrier, enhancing patient comfort and promoting the environmental stability of the exposed surgical site, such as in the management of pain and irritation following a tooth removal.

What side effects are possible with Dry Socket Paste?

The safety profile of this dental preparation, which utilizes the active ingredients Eugenol and Guaiacol, is predominantly defined by localized reactions consistent with its topical application and minimal systemic absorption.

Officially Documented Adverse Reactions

The most commonly documented adverse events, based on regulatory classification of these phenol derivatives, are confined to the application site. These include local irritation and reactions classified under the Dermatological System as allergic contact dermatitis. The official safety framework considers these effects as the primary expected reactions associated with the paste.

Hypersensitivity and Serious Risk

Adverse effects related to the Immune System are a critical safety consideration. The product is strictly contraindicated in any individual with a known or suspected hypersensitivity to Eugenol, Guaiacol, or other components of the formulation. Although rare, systemic hypersensitivity reactions, including the potential for anaphylaxis, are officially documented as a possibility, which constitutes a serious adverse reaction.

Time-Related Safety Patterns

Regulatory safety information notes that local adverse effects, such as allergic sensitization and contact dermatitis, may be associated with prolonged or repeated exposure to the active ingredients. This contrasts with effects that might be more prominent during the initial application. Given the localized nature, specific safety concerns related to systemic organ impairment (e.g., renal or hepatic function) are not generally included in the official prescribing information.

Overdose and Emergency Response

Overdose and when to seek help

Overdose with Dry Socket Paste, containing Eugenol and Guaiacol, is officially documented following gross ingestion or excessive systemic exposure beyond intended use. Regulatory information details specific clinical manifestations that may occur, including gastrointestinal disturbances such as nausea, vomiting, and abdominal pain. Central Nervous System (CNS) effects are also listed, typically presenting as drowsiness, dizziness, stupor, and vertigo, alongside the auditory symptom of tinnitus.

Regulators classify severe overdose with this compound as having the potential for life-threatening outcomes. Documented serious manifestations include seizures, profound CNS depression leading to coma, severe metabolic acidosis, respiratory compromise, and organ system failure affecting the hepatic (liver) and renal (kidney) systems. Official labeling notes an increased vulnerability to severe effects in pediatric patients and those with pre-existing hepatic or renal impairment.

Official regulatory instruction mandates that individuals must seek immediate medical attention and contact emergency services or a Poison Control Center immediately upon the suspicion of overdose or the onset of severe systemic signs. Management is strictly symptomatic and supportive, as official documentation confirms that no specific antidote is known.

Therapeutic Uses of Dry Socket Paste

What Dry Socket Paste Treats: Main Uses and Benefits

Relief for Severe Post-Extraction Pain Crisis

This specialized dental paste is commonly used to help address the acute, severe, and persistent pain experienced when the protective blood clot fails to form or is lost after a tooth extraction, a condition known as Alveolar Osteitis (Dry Socket). Management of this condition focuses primarily on symptom relief. The paste is applied in clinical settings that involve acute or unstable symptom patterns to provide targeted symptomatic relief from the intense, throbbing ache and radiating facial discomfort, which generally is not eased by standard over-the-counter medication.

Management of Alveolar Osteitis and Surgical Site Exposure

The primary therapeutic applications include the management of Alveolar Osteitis and the provision of protective support for the exposed alveolar socket. Dry Socket Paste is applied as a specialized professional dressing where bone and nerve endings are exposed, offering a supportive, soothing action directly onto the irritated nerve tissue. This is relevant in contexts marked by increased discomfort and tension, supporting patients during episodes of heightened discomfort.

Eligibility and Restrictions for Use

Who Can and Cannot Use Dry Socket Paste?

The eligibility for Dry Socket Paste, featuring the active ingredients Eugenol and Guaiacol, is defined by strict regulatory criteria, primarily related to allergies and the establishment of safety data in specific populations.


Contraindicated Populations (Must Not Use)

The medicine is contraindicated and must not be used by individuals with a known hypersensitivity or allergic reaction to its components, specifically the active ingredients Eugenol or Guaiacol. Certain formulations may also prohibit use in patients sensitive to ingredients like procaine-type anesthetics or iodine compounds.


Restricted and Conditional Use

Population Group Eligibility Status (Regulatory)
General Adult Patients Allowed for the treatment of alveolar osteitis (dry socket).
Pregnant Individuals Restricted. Not recommended without prior physician consultation due to a lack of definitive safety data.
Lactating Patients Not Established. Official labeling often states that no data is available regarding excretion into breast milk.
Pediatric Patients Use is subject to the discretion of a dental professional. Safety and efficacy in this population are generally not explicitly established in regulatory labeling.

The overall use of Dry Socket Paste is restricted to professional dental use only, meaning application is constrained to a clinical setting by a licensed professional.

What should I know about interactions with other medicines?

Interactions with other medicines and products

Official Regulatory Interaction Profile

The regulatory labeling for Dry Socket Paste, a localized dental preparation containing Eugenol and Guaiacol, primarily defines its interaction profile through a single, mandatory restriction concerning substance sensitivity. Use of the paste is formally contraindicated in any patient who has a known hypersensitivity or allergy to either of the active ingredients, Eugenol or Guaiacol, as documented in official prescribing information.

Consistent with its highly localized and non-systemic application, the product’s official regulatory profile does not list or classify any systemic drug-drug interactions. The absence of such data means there are no documented instances of pharmacokinetic interactions, such as those related to CYP enzyme pathways, or pharmacodynamic interactions that result in additive effects with other medicines.

Absence of Documented Systemic Interactions

Official government sources do not require mandatory timing-based rules for separating the application of the dental paste from other oral or topical medicines. Furthermore, the labeling does not formally document any interactions involving food, alcohol, herbal products, or dietary supplements that would necessitate consumption restrictions. The interaction profile is therefore strictly confined to the local restriction related to known substance sensitivity, and it does not include the detailed systemic interaction tables common to oral or injectable medications.

Interaction Type Regulatory Status (Topical Paste)
Contraindicated Combinations Known sensitivity to Eugenol or Guaiacol
Systemic Drug-Drug Interactions NONE formally documented
Food / Alcohol / Herbal Interactions NONE formally documented
Timing Separation Rules NONE formally documented

Mechanism of Action

The paste's action is governed by a localized, multi-domain mechanistic profile.

Direct Blockade of Neural Impulse Conduction

This mechanism relies on Eugenol's ability to target and inhibit voltage-gated sodium channels (VGSCs) on peripheral nerve fibers. This interaction blocks the rapid influx of sodium ions necessary for generating an electrical signal, functionally stopping the propagation of the signal. This engagement with the nociceptive signaling pathway leads to the physiological consequence of interrupted signal conduction and localized neural insensitivity.

Modulation of Local Inflammatory Mediators

Active ingredients also act within the local inflammatory pathway by inhibiting the Cyclooxygenase-2 (COX-2) enzyme. This enzymatic suppression reduces the synthesis of the pain-sensitizing mediator, Prostaglandin E2 ( PGE2). By modulating the concentration of these local mediators, the mechanism affects nerve ending excitability and reduces local vascular permeability.

Non-Specific Microbial Cell Disruption

This mechanistic domain involves both Eugenol and Guaiacol engaging in a non-specific disruption of microbial cell membranes. As phenolic compounds, they intercalate into the lipid bilayer, compromising the structural integrity and causing leakage of intracellular contents. This mechanistic cascade results in the suppression of microbial cell proliferation and viability in the peripheral tissues.

Dosage and Administration Information

How Dry Socket Paste is Used: Official Administration Principles

The administration of Dry Socket Paste (containing Guaiacol and Eugenol) is governed by specific, high-level usage principles that define its function as a professional intra-alveolar dressing. Official labeling emphasizes its restricted route, specific application context, and passive duration pattern.


Administration Scope

The medicine is strictly designated for DENTAL administration via the Topical route, requiring direct placement Intra-alveolar (within the extraction socket). The application must be carried out in a clinical setting, as the product is designated for professional dental use only. A primary constraint is the instruction to Do not swallow the paste or take it internally.

Entity Instruction Principle
Route of administration Topical / Intra-alveolar placement
Dosing schedule principle Apply sufficient quantity to fill the socket and cover all exposed bone.
Preparation Socket must be thoroughly rinsed and de-brided prior to application.
Frequency Single application per treatment episode.

Procedural and Duration Structure

The usage protocol begins with the required thorough cleaning and rinsing of the socket to prepare the site. The paste is then placed intra-alveolarly using a flat-bladed instrument or syringe until all exposed bone is covered, followed by tamping it down to secure it. This is a single treatment designed to remain in the wound for a short-term duration of 3 to 5 days. The formulation allows the paste to gradually wash out as the socket heals naturally, meaning a separate patient visit for removal is not typically required.

Recent Clinical Evidence

Research evidence / Overview of studies for Dry Socket Paste


Evidence for Managing Alveolar Osteitis (Dry Socket)

Research examining Dry Socket Paste, which contains ingredients like Eugenol and Guaiacol, has been conducted in studies involving patients with Alveolar Osteitis (dry socket). This condition is characterized by acute or disruptive episodes of severe pain following a tooth extraction. The available evidence includes Randomized Controlled Trials (RCTs) and systematic reviews that synthesize data from available comparative trials.

Studies explored the treatment by comparing the medicated paste to other types of dental dressings or local treatments. Studies observed how patients reported their experiences after the medicated paste was evaluated over defined, short-term time intervals. The research helps to show what has been observed so far when this specific type of medicated dressing was studied for outcomes related to post-extraction pain.


Outcomes Tracked in Clinical Trials

The research examined several specific outcomes related to physical discomfort during periods of heightened symptom activity. The studies focused on precise measurements of patient-reported experiences. For example, researchers conducted studies exploring how symptoms changed over time by tracking pain intensity using rating scales at short intervals, such as 24 and 72 hours after application.

Other key aspects research examined included the measurement of symptomatic change over time, which helps contextualize how patients reported their experience over the days following treatment. Additionally, studies monitored the patients’ use of painkillers (rescue medication) to monitoring of analgesic intake. Findings describe patterns observed in the studies related to these various outcomes, but research does not determine whether an individual will respond similarly.


Study Duration and Follow-up Assessment

Research explored the paste in settings where symptoms had become more noticeable. The follow-up durations were limited, mainly focusing on short-term symptom changes. This means the research focuses on changes measured during the immediate days following the dry socket diagnosis. Patients was observed in studies over periods of up to 5 to 7 days for primary outcomes related to patient-reported discomfort, with some assessments extending up to 20 days for the final healing status.

The study of long-term healing, complications, or recurrence over periods of several months is not fully established. The study results reflect the specific conditions under which they were conducted, and data are still emerging regarding extended recovery and the prevention of recurrence.


Evidence in Study Populations

Data for certain groups remain insufficient. Evidence for subgroups, such as older adults with specific comorbidities or patients under 18 years of age, is limited. Therefore, results apply only to the populations studied, and findings describing group patterns may not apply to all potential patient scenarios.

Frequently Asked Questions (FAQ)

Common questions about Dry Socket Paste (FAQ)

Q: Is it normal to taste or smell the paste for a long time?

A: It is common for patients to notice the taste or smell of the paste while it is in the socket. The paste contains the active components Eugenol and Guaiacol. Official product information describes these as distinct chemical compounds known to have strong, noticeable tastes and odors, such as clove-like or smoky.

Q: Can Dry Socket Paste be used for regular toothaches?

A: According to official regulatory documents, Dry Socket Paste is specifically indicated for the treatment of Alveolar Osteitis, which is commonly known as dry socket syndrome. Its regulatory labeling does not include or describe its use for general or routine toothaches, as it is a specialized dressing for a post-extraction complication.

Q: Can the paste cause irritation to my gums?

A: Official reports on the product’s safety indicate that the most commonly documented adverse reactions are confined to the application site. These localized effects include local irritation and reactions classified as allergic contact dermatitis. Irritation to the surrounding gums may be one manifestation of these known local reactions.

Q: Will Dry Socket Paste stain my teeth?

A: Regulatory documents list the ingredients of the paste, which may contain an inactive component like Yellow Wax that contributes to the product's color. While official regulatory labels detail the components, they do not generally include specific information or warnings regarding long-term tooth staining.

Q: Is it normal if the paste starts dissolving slowly?

A: The gradual wash-out of the dressing is consistent with its expected function. The paste is formulated in a way that allows it to gradually wash out of the surgical site as the socket heals naturally. This slow process of breakdown and removal occurs over its intended duration of use, typically 3 to 5 days.

Q: Can I accidentally swallow some of the Dry Socket Paste?

A: Regulatory labeling includes a specific caution that the product should not be swallowed or taken internally. This caution reflects that the product is strictly designed for local, topical application within the extraction site.

Q: Does Dry Socket Paste contain eugenol?

A: Yes, official regulatory labeling and product inserts confirm that Eugenol is included as one of the active ingredients in the paste. Eugenol is a phenol derivative often recognized for its soothing effects on nerve endings.

Q: Can the paste cause stomach upset if I swallow a little?

A: Regulatory documents state that the paste should not be swallowed. Authoritative information on the active ingredient Eugenol notes that accidental ingestion may potentially cause adverse effects such as nausea, vomiting, and gastroenteritis (stomach upset).

Q: How does the paste compare to just leaving the socket alone?

A: Dry Socket Paste is indicated for treating an exposed surgical site in order to provide localized relief and protection. Its dual function is to deliver analgesic (pain-soothing) effects and antiseptic action. Therefore, its intended purpose is to actively manage symptoms and stabilize the exposed area, which differs from leaving the socket untreated.

Q: Is Dry Socket Paste considered a drug or a medical device?

A: Based on official US regulatory classification, the product is designated as a drug. It is listed as a dental paste dosage form, has an NDC number, and is categorized within the official Mouth and Throat Products drug class.

Q: Are there any long-term side effects noted in official reports?

A: Official safety information primarily details localized adverse effects. The safety framework notes that local effects like allergic sensitization may be associated with prolonged or repeated exposure. Studies typically track patient-reported symptoms and healing only over short intervals of days, meaning data regarding extended recovery and recurrence are still emerging.

Q: What color is Dry Socket Paste usually?

A: The paste's color is not explicitly listed in official product descriptions. However, the inactive ingredients often include substances like Yellow Wax, which generally contribute a yellow or off-white color to the finished dental preparation.

Q: Are there different brands of Dry Socket Paste, and are they the same?

A: There are different commercially available preparations. While many popular products contain the core active ingredients Eugenol and Guaiacol, other preparations marketed for dry socket may use different active components, such as iodoform or different types of anesthetics. Therefore, formulations are not uniformly the same across all brands.

How should Dry Socket Paste be stored and disposed of?

The storage and disposal of Dry Socket Paste are governed by specific regulatory requirements to maintain product stability and safety.

Storage Conditions

Official labeling requires the paste to be stored at controlled room temperature, specifically between 59 F and 86 F (15 C and 30 C). It is mandatory to protect the product from freezing, as this can compromise the formulation's integrity. As a standard precaution, the paste must be kept out of reach of children.

Disposal

Since this product is designated for professional dental use only, specific instructions for household disposal are not detailed in the public labeling. Disposal of any unused or expired paste should adhere to the established pharmaceutical waste protocols of the administering healthcare facility.
